What to check before for good cause buildings near transit in Wakefield

  • Use the “good cause” filter to focus on buildings where certain rent increases and non-renewal rules are more limited; still verify your specific lease terms in writing.
  • Treat “near transit” as an address-level commute check. Confirm the closest stops, walking time, and line reliability for your schedule.
  • Compare multiple buildings side-by-side: look for patterns in reported responsiveness, maintenance follow-through, and clarity of move-in requirements.
  • Ask how the building handles renewals, administrative fees, and any landlord paperwork related to tenant eligibility under the good-cause framework.
  • Before signing, confirm the full monthly cost beyond rent (e.g., deposits and other common move-in charges) since affordability depends on total out-of-pocket costs.
